badderlocks
/ˈbædəˌlɒks/(亦作dabberlocks)
plural noun
1- chiefly Scottish an edible seaweed with a long greenish frond and prominent midrib, occurring in northern Europe〈主苏格兰〉翅菜。
1.1
- Alaria esculenta, class Phaeophyceae.拉丁名Alaria esculenta,褐藻纲。
词源
late 18th cent.: perhaps from Balderlocks, based on the name of the god BALDER.
